Feeding Tips for a Healthy Puppy
Feeding your puppy the right amount of food at the right time is crucial for their health and well-being. Here are some feeding tips to keep in mind:
- Feed your puppy 3-4 times a day until they are about six months old, then you can gradually switch to twice a day.
- Choose a high-quality puppy food that is rich in protein and fat to support their growth and development.
- Divide your puppy’s daily ration into smaller meals to prevent overeating and reduce the risk of digestive problems.
- Monitor your puppy’s weight and adjust their food intake accordingly to prevent obesity.
- Avoid over-supplementing your puppy’s diet with vitamins and minerals, as this can lead to an imbalance of nutrients.
Best Puppy Food for Optimal Growth
With so many puppy food options available, it can be overwhelming to choose the best one for your furry friend. When selecting a puppy food, look for the following characteristics:
- High-quality protein sources such as chicken, salmon, or lamb.
- Whole grains such as brown rice, oats, or barley.
- Fruits and vegetables such as carrots, sweet potatoes, or green beans.
- No fillers or by-products.
- Formulated to meet the specific needs of your puppy’s breed, size, and age.
Some excellent puppy food options include grain-free puppy food, organic puppy food, and puppy food specifically formulated for large breeds or small breeds.
